Onboarding note for the Ledgerpane admin table: bulk edits are applied through the batcher service, not directly against the database. Select rows, choose an action, and the batcher stages changes in a pending set you can review before commit. Edits over 500 rows require a second approver — this is enforced server-side, so don't try to chunk around it. To run the batcher locally you need the staging write credential, which goes in your .env as the next line.

secret setting of bahip-kagag: RELAY_SECRET3=c83

= Schema Registry Quotas =

Welcome aboard! Our event schema registry (we call it Hatchline) keeps every producer honest, but it's not a free-for-all. Each team gets a capped number of subjects, versions per subject, and compatibility-check requests per minute. Blow past a quota and registration calls return a retryable error, so don't panic — just back off. If you genuinely need more headroom, ping the platform channel. Here are the current limits.

tuning constants:
QUOTAS = {
    "druwyn": 5,
    "holix": 5,
    "zorath": 5,
    "holwyn": 10,
}

### Firmware Update Channel

Support folks: when a customer's Wrenlet device seems stuck on old firmware, check which update channel it's subscribed to via GET /v1/devices/{serial}/channel. Channels are `stable`, `beta`, and `canary` — most field units should be on `stable`. You can move a device between channels with a PATCH, and the change takes effect at the next check-in (roughly every six hours). These calls go through the internal PulseRelay service, so you'll need the key below.

app token of yahop-fafof = kto3_p5z

**Ticket: Staging scheduler misconfigured — nightly backfills not firing**

New folks: the Cobblebrook scheduler runs data backfills at 02:00 and reads its config from `backfill.env`. Staging was pointed at the retired queue, so jobs silently no-op'd. Fix is to restore the correct queue name and re-add the worker credential. The scheduler's queue access secret goes on the next line.

sealed setting: LEDGER_TOKEN13=5d842615a26d7